Sha256: dc487d78abd287ff15af95e24b5e26972be7882d6c3ee377d2bdcbadecd07121
Contents?: true
Size: 913 Bytes
Versions: 6
Compression:
Stored size: 913 Bytes
Contents
class Admin::FlickrsController < Admin::BaseController def create flickr = Flickr.new("#{RAILS_ROOT}/config/flickr.yml") redirect_to flickr.auth.url(:write) end def show respond_to do |format| format.html do flickr = Flickr.new("#{RAILS_ROOT}/config/flickr.yml") flickr.auth.cache_token end format.js end end def index respond_to do |format| format.js do if defined?(Flickr) and File.exists?("#{RAILS_ROOT}/config/flickr.yml") flickr = Flickr.new("#{RAILS_ROOT}/config/flickr.yml") flickr_params = { :per_page => '12', :page => params[:page], :user_id => Settings.flickr_user_id, :sort => 'date-taken-desc', :tag_mode => 'all' } flickr_params[:tags] = params[:tags] unless params[:tags].blank? @flickr_result = flickr.photos.search(flickr_params) end end end end end
Version data entries
6 entries across 6 versions & 1 rubygems